  11.    Great Josh was back yesterday.

       Completion percentage in the 70s, interception rate in the zeros (😜). Eye test tells us he was decisive and pulled the trigger quicker. 

        And, Dime DROPPING!!!! He threw 4 

    beautiful long balls. Two ended up as touchdown. One to Diggs was broken up by a perfectly timed high point tip by the DB. The other to Kincaid (?) in the front corner of the end zone was thrown from the other side of the field, under pressure, and was also broken up by a great DB play. But, those two breakups were still great throws. Not over or under but right where they needed to be.

        Josh also played no hero ball to my eye. He took a few sacks that were advisable while protecting the ball. These were positive plays and I said so in the moment. He didn’t throw a single pass I saw that looked like a bad or forced decision.

        Add in the legs and the second longest QB rushing TD in playoff history and opponents have to keep a spy in which opens up the backside passing a bit more.

        The whole team seemed to respond to him and the situation as well.

       I include Brady in this as he seemed to have dialed up a plan that specifically targeted the Steelers for those early TDs ( and the missed one to Diggs) 

        Defensive injuries are what they are at this point. But, if we are going to be underperforming on that side of the ball, 2021 Playoff Josh is exactly who we need.
